My distrust of Steel has been super vindicated ohhoHO man.
Like, on the surface it SEEMS that everything is on the up and up. Steel is telling Suvi exactly how the plan will work. She's recording their conversation. She's praising Suvi by calling her "brilliant" over and over.
But that's what makes the Geas even more sinister, imo. Not only does Suvi not have the option of saying "no" -- but it's arguably one of the worst things that could be done to her specifically. Yes, Steel is laying out the plan step-by-step. But she's not telling Suvi exactly what hiding this music box is supposed to do. She left that very crucial detail out.
Aabria has said before that Suvi can handle just about anything as long as she has all the information. In this very episode, as Suvi struggles to remember the compulsion being cast on her, she says: "I know, and that makes it okay" before surrendering.
But she doesn't know, does she? Not really -- not the knowing that truly matters. It was stolen from her. Aabria literally describes the whole process as "an obliteration of agency and understanding." And worst of all, Steel tells Suvi she must follow the orders she'll have no memory of receiving "at any cost".
Not only does Suvi risk running afoul of the witches, she also may be harmed by the very spell her beloved guardian put on her. There is a chance, however slight, that Suvi could die.
And she would die without truly understanding why.
I have no doubt that Steel loves Suvi deeply. But she is, first and foremost, the Sword of the Citadel. Before Steel and Suvi are mother and daughter, they are soldier and commander.
"You will do this. And it will work."

“Sometimes people stab you with a knife, and it sticks in your body, but if you’re clever enough, now you have a new knife”
This is so so cool and also the perfect mask-slip moment for Steel, the first thing that really makes Ame a bit more cautious and withdrawn during her conversation, it’s just so so good! Like, for all of Steel’s genuine respect for the customs and traditions and titles of Witches and Spirits, she is absolutely still the Sword of the Citadel, a powerful leader of Empire and Warfare. She clearly admired and respects Grandmother Ren, and she truly wants to help Ame be rid of the curse, but also, why not find out how it works first, use it our advantage? How useful would it be to be able to delete important memories and intel from the minds of enemies of the Citadel?
Steel says she’s coming to free Naram, but if she finds out exactly the kind of weapon He is, the way Morrow could harness Him to decimate other nations, would she really throw that kind of opportunity away? She is a woman in the middle of a war, losing soldiers every day according to Suvi. What exactly are the lines she would not cross in order to protect the nation she has given everything to serve?

I've seen people speculating that Steel betrayed Suvi's parents, and while I think the impulse not to trust Steel is absolutely justified, I don't buy the theory that she was directly involved in their deaths.
This is Brennan and Aabria we're talking about, whose narrative sensibilities I trust implicitly, and thus I don't think they're going to do something as unsubtle as revealing her to have been Secretly Evil The Whole Time. If there's one thing I trust this group of people to do, it's to have something interesting to say about imperialism and nationalist indoctrination and wherein lies the complicated blame for those things on the scale of the family unit.
I think if Steel is going to be a plot device to represent anything, it will be the idea that someone can love you and care for you and genuinely do Their Best in raising you, and none of that precludes the possibility of them doing incalculable harm to you in the process. I think Steel does love Suvi, but the problem is that she loves the Citadel far more, and that convinction informed every aspect of Suvi's upbringing.
Suvi, as demonstrated by the events of this last episode, has a lot to unlearn - and we're along for the ride, I'd imagine.
